Barbituric acid, the base material of barbiturates, was first synthesized in 1863 by Adolph von Bayer. His company later went on to synthesize aspirin for the first time, and Bayer aspirin is still a popular brand today.

Throughout history, plants containing cardiac steroids have been used as heart drugs and as poisons (e.g., in arrows used in combat), emetics, and diuretics.

Normal urine is sterile. It contains fluids, salts, and waste products. It is free of bacteria, viruses, and fungi.

More than 2,500 barbiturates have been synthesized. At the height of their popularity, about 50 were marketed for human use.

The first war in which wide-scale use of anesthetics occurred was the Civil War, and 80% of all wounds were in the extremities.
